A conduit cap is a small part with an outsized job: it closes off an open duct so water, dirt, and debris stay out until cable is pulled. On an underground electrical or broadband project, an unsealed conduit invites mud, silt, and groundwater into the duct — fouling the path long before anyone runs a cable. Choosing the right cap comes down to two things: the conduit type and the trade size. This guide explains how Schedule 40, Schedule 80, EB, and DB conduit relate to one another, and how to pick a cap that fits.

Schedule 40 vs. Schedule 80: it’s about wall thickness

“Schedule” refers to the wall thickness of the conduit. For a given trade size, Schedule 80 conduit has a thicker wall than Schedule 40, which gives it a higher pressure and impact rating — useful where conduit is exposed to physical damage or stubs up out of the ground.

Here is the part that matters for caps: a thicker wall means a smaller inside diameter, but the outside diameter stays the same for a given trade size. Schedule 40 and Schedule 80 of the same trade size share the same outside dimension; only the bore changes.

Because a cap slips over the conduit and seals against its outside diameter, a cap sized to a trade size fits both Schedule 40 and Schedule 80 of that size. You do not need a separate cap for each schedule — you size by trade size and the cap covers both.

What EB and DB conduit are

Two more conduit types show up constantly on underground jobs:

  • EB — encased burial. Conduit engineered to be surrounded by concrete in a duct bank. The concrete carries the structural load, so EB conduit can use a relatively economical wall.
  • DB — direct burial. Conduit engineered to be buried directly in the earth without a concrete envelope, so it is built to handle backfill and soil loads on its own.

Both are common on utility, municipal, and data-center work, and both leave open duct ends that need to be capped until the pull is made.

Two styles to choose from

There are two cap styles, and the choice depends on what happens after the duct is sealed:

  • PVC end caps — the plain style. A clean push-on cap that closes the conduit opening, offered in trade sizes ½” through 6”. This is the right choice wherever you simply need to keep the duct sealed against water and debris.
  • Riser caps — the same protective seal, plus a molded rope-tie loop, offered in trade sizes 1.5” through 6”. The loop lets you anchor a pull-line / mule tape inside the conduit so the pull string is staged and ready when the crew comes back to pull cable. Riser caps are the practical pick on stub-ups and risers where a pull line needs to live in the duct.

If you are not sure which style a run needs, a good rule of thumb is: seal-only runs take a plain end cap, while any conduit that should carry a staged pull line takes a riser cap.

What is the difference between Schedule 40 and Schedule 80 conduit?
Schedule 40 and Schedule 80 describe wall thickness for a given trade size. Schedule 80 has a thicker wall and a correspondingly smaller inside diameter, while the outside diameter stays the same as Schedule 40. Because a cap slips over the conduit by its outside diameter, a trade-size cap fits both schedules.
What are EB and DB conduit?
EB stands for encased burial conduit, designed to be surrounded by concrete in a duct bank. DB stands for direct burial conduit, designed to be buried directly in the ground without concrete encasement.
